In excel, I have hyperlinks in a main worksheet that link to a secondary
worksheet. Once the user is done viewing secondary worksheet, I 'd like the back button to return the user to the main worksheet and close the secondary worksheet. How do I get the back button to automatically close the secondary worksheet before returning to the main worksheet. |
